Logic Breakdown
Passage Summary: A spokesperson claims their expensive products are the best, arguing that if a cheaper item were actually good, the price would naturally be higher.
Conclusion: The company's products are the best available because they are the most expensive.
Reasoning: If a competitor's cheaper product were actually as good as or better than the company's product, it would necessarily cost as much or more.
Analysis: This argument is a classic example of circular reasoning, also known as begging the question. The spokesperson assumes that price is a perfect, infallible proxy for quality to prove that their high price proves high quality. It’s a bit like saying 'I am the smartest person because I say so, and I wouldn't lie because I'm the smartest.' Look for an answer choice that identifies this circularity or the unwarranted assumption that price must reflect quality.

Unlock Full Passage19.The reasoning in the company spokesperson's argument is flawed in that the argument
Correct Answer
A
A identifies classic begging the question: the premise assumes that if a competitor’s product were as good or better, it would necessarily be priced as high or higher—i.e., that price tracks quality so tightly that only the best can be the most expensive. That presupposes the conclusion that the most expensive (their) products are the best.
